When patients miss many teeth in the mouth, it drastically changes their quality of life. Significant tooth loss makes it difficult for patients to eat and chew properly. This can affect their physical health in terms of nutrition deficiencies. Patients missing multiple teeth may also have difficulty speaking as the orofacial structure changes. In addition, interpersonal relationships may suffer for these patients due to self-consciousness regarding their appearance due to extreme tooth gaps.

Difference Between Partials and Full Dentures

Our dentist near you will determine whether you need partials or full dentures depending on your mouth’s condition and the number of teeth. If any of your teeth are intact and healthy enough to avoid extraction, they will remain in the gums, and you will be fitted for partial dentures. If you have total tooth loss in either your upper or lower jaw, or both, or if you require total extraction of all your teeth, full dentures are the solution to restore your oral health and function.

Adjusting to Dentures

Whether you need partials or full dentures, they require periodic adjustments as the mouth changes shape over time. Our dentist in Jackson, MI, will ensure a fit in the mouth when dentures are first created for a patient. However, changes in the gum tissue and other factors may cause dentures to slip, create sore spots, or develop problems with chewing.
